ST Adds STM32F7 MCU Line for Easy Access to High-Performance Embedded Designs
Expanding accessories and options for the related development ecosystem
STMicroelectronics (hereinafter ST) announced the launch of a new STM32F7 microcontroller line that enables easy access to high-performance embedded designs based on ARM® Cortex®-M7 cores, and the expansion of accessories and options for the related development ecosystem.
The newly released microcontrollers STM32F722 and STM32F723 integrate code execution protection and high-speed USB PHY (Physical-layer) circuitry. This allows for reduced memory capacity, simplifying the development of connected applications. The variants, the STM32F732 and STM32F733, also provide separate on-chip encryption features. There are various package options available, ranging from 64 pins to a maximum of 176 pins in LQFP, and UFBGA packages are available for projects requiring high I/O counts. On-chip flash memory can be selected up to 256KB or 512KB, and 256KB of RAM is supplied alongside the device.

Pin, package, and software compatibility is excellent even between the new products and high-end STM32F7 variants.
Flash memory is available in sizes ranging from 256KB to 2MB, and RAM from 256KB to 512KB; packages up to 216-pin TFBGA are also available. This simplifies design, contributing to product differentiation and long-term product value. Furthermore, STM32F7-based projects can be easily ported to any product within the broad STM32 microcontroller family. ST's STM32 product family consists of over 700 products, supports all 32-bit Cortex-M cores, and offers a variety of peripherals, pin counts, and memory options.
ST also introduced a Discovery Kit based on the STM32F769, featuring an expansion connector including an 8-pin socket for a Wi-Fi module. This product supports Power over Ethernet (PoE) and includes a 512Mbit Quad-SPI (QSPI) flash interface, along with new accessories that enhance flexibility and expand application areas.
For example, various displays can be attached using the 15-pin single-column FPC adapter board B-LCDAD-RPI1 and the DSI-HDMI adapter B-LCDAD-HDMI1. This kit comes in two versions: the 4-inch WVGA capacitive touchscreen display B-LCD40-DSI, or a version without a display for cost-effectiveness. The B-LCD40-DSI can be purchased separately if a kit upgrade is needed later.
Sales have begun for the STM32F769 Discovery Kit equipped with a wireless-enabled base board (starting at $49), DSI and HDMI display-adapter boards, and the 4-inch WVGA MIPI-DSI touchscreen LCD. The STM32F722/723 and STM32F732/733 microcontroller lines with added encryption features are scheduled for mass production in the first quarter of 2017, with the LQFP64 package-based STM32F722RET6 starting at $5.04 (in 10,000-unit quantities).
